AFLR3 Parameter Options

Parameter options are specified as follows

   aflr3 name_1=value_1 name_2=value_2 ...

This will set parameter "name_1" to "value_1", "name_2" to "value_2", etc. Where
"name_1", "name_2", etc. are names for program parameters. These parameters are
used to implement the previously described option flags. They also provide
detailed control over all aspects of the program operation.

Parameter Input File
====================

Within the program, a parameter input file is read to set the parameter options.
This script creates a parameter input file automatically. The parameter input
file must be a formatted ASCII file of the following form.

   name_1 value_1
   name_2 value_2
   name_3 value_3
   .
   .
   .
   name_N value_N

where name_# is the name of a parameter and value_# is the corresponding value.
Note that the = sign is not used between the name and value as it is on the
command line. Any number of blank lines may be included in the file and any
number of blank spaces may be contained before, after, and between "name_#" and
"value_#". A name, "name_#", must exactly match a name used in the following
descriptions to actually set the parameter within the program.

Program Parameters
==================

The following is a complete list of program parameters. Many of these can only
be set using a parameter option. Many of these parameters should never be
changed. They are listed here only to allow very expert users complete control
over the program.

 
Default   Minimum   Maximum   Parameter
Value     Value     Value     Name and Description
-------   -------   -------   --------------------
0         0         1         File_Status_Monitor_Flag
                              File status monitor flag.               
                              If File_Status_Monitor_Flag = 0 then do 
                              not turn on file status monitor.        
                              If File_Status_Monitor_Flag = 1 then    
                              turn on file status monitor. If the file
                              status monitor is on then an output     
                              message is generated each time a file is
                              opened or modified.                     
 
0         0         1         Memory_Monitor_Flag     
                              Memory monitor flag.                    
                              If Memory_Monitor_Flag = 0 then do not  
                              turn on memory monitor.                 
                              If Memory_Monitor_Flag = 1 then turn on 
                              memory monitor. If the memory monitor is
                              on then an output message is generated  
                              each time memory is allocated, re-      
                              allocated, or freed.                    
 
1         0         10000000  Message_Flag            
                              Message flag.                           
                              If Message_Flag = 0 then generate       
                              minimal output messages.                
                              If Message_Flag = 1 then generate       
                              normal output messages.                 
                              This is an AFLR3_SYSTEM LIB parameter.  
 
0         0         2         Output_File_Flag        
                              Output file flag.                       
                              If Output_File_Flag = 0 then send all   
                              output to only standard output or       
                              standard error.                         
                              If Output_File_Flag = 1 then send       
                              informational output to both standard   
                              output (or standard error) and a file   
                              named case_name.aflr3.out.              
                              If Output_File_Flag = 2 then send       
                              informational output to a file named    
                              case_name.aflr3.out only. Error messages
                              will go to both the file and standard   
                              error.                                  
                              This is an AFLR3_SYSTEM LIB parameter.  
 
0         0         1         Set_Vol_ID_Flag         
                              Set volume element ID flag.             
                              If Set_Vol_ID_Flag = 0 and              
                              Program_Flag > 0 then do not allocate or
                              set the volume element ID.              
                              If Set_Vol_ID_Flag = 0 and              
                              Program_Flag = 0 then do not reset the  
                              volume element ID.                      
                              If Set_Vol_ID_Flag = 1 then allocate and
                              set the volume element ID to a unique   
                              value for each solid in the domain.     
                              This is an AFLR3_SYSTEM LIB parameter.  
 
0         0         1         Tags_Data_File_Flag     
                              Tags data file flag.                    
                              If Tags_Data_File_Flag = 1 then check   
                              for and read any TAGS data file with    
                              the same case name as the input grid.   
                              If Tags_Data_File_Flag = 0 then ignore  
                              any TAGS data file.                     
                              This is an AFLR3_SYSTEM LIB parameter.  
 
1         1         2         mchkvol                 
                              Final element volume check flag.        
                              If mchkvol = 1 then exit if any         
                              element volume is less than tolerance.  
                              If mchkvol = 2 then output location of  
                              any element volume that is less than    
                              tolerance and do not exit.              
 
1         1         2         mdf                     
                              Distribution function flag.             
                              If mdf = 1 then interpolate the node    
                              distribution function for new nodes     
                              from the containing element.            
                              If mdf = 2 then use geometric growth    
                              from the boundaries to determine the    
                              distribution function for new nodes.    
 
1         0         1         mdflim                  
                              Distribution function limiting flag.    
                              If mdflim = 0 then do not limit the     
                              distribution function.                  
                              If mdflim = 1 then limit the            
                              distribution function by the minimum    
                              local boundary edge length multiplied by
                              the satisfied edge length multiplier,   
                              cdff.                                   
                              This option is intended to limit the    
                              distribution function for cases with    
                              high-aspect-ratio faces on boundary     
                              surfaces.                               
 
1         0         1         mdfs                    
                              Quality field sliver deletion flag.     
                              If mdfs = 1 then add nodes to delete    
                              field sliver elements during quality    
                              improvement.                            
                              If mdfs = 0 then do not add nodes to    
                              delete field sliver elements during     
                              quality improvement.                    
 
0         0         2000000000melem                   
                              Maximum number of elements.             
                              All dimensions key off this parameter.  
                              If melem = 0 then the code estimates the
                              required dimensions.                    
                              If melem > 0 then the code estimates are
                              ignored and all dimensions are initially
                              set based on the value of melem.        
                              In either case the code will reallocate 
                              memory as needed during grid generation.
 
1         0         1         minlpp                  
                              Initial centroid point placement flag.  
                              During grid generation large elements   
                              that have all edges larger than the     
                              distribution function (local point      
                              spacing) are subdivided using centroid  
                              point placement.                        
                              If minlpp = 1 then use initial centroid 
                              point placement.                        
                              If minlpp = 0 then do not use initial   
                              centroid point placement.               
 
0         0         2         mlsr                    
                              Length scale ratio improvement flag.    
                              Source nodes can be generated to improve
                              the minimum length scale ratio          
                              (LSRatio), minimum point spacing over   
                              distance between boundaries.            
                              If mlsr = 0 then do not use length scale
                              ratio (LSRatio) improvement.            
                              If mlsr = 1 then use surface mode source
                              node length scale ratio (LSRatio)       
                              improvement. In this case, source nodes 
                              are created on a nested set of embedded 
                              rectangular surfaces. If the boundary   
                              is a single solid then iterative mode   
                              (mlsr=2) is selected instead.           
                              If mlsr = 2 then use iterative mode     
                              source node length scale ratio (LSRatio)
                              improvement. In this case, source nodes 
                              are created iteratively during initial  
                              grid generation as elements with small  
                              length scale ratios are created.        
 
2         1         2         mpp                     
                              Point placement flag.                   
                              If mpp = 1 then use centroid point      
                              placement. Centroid placement is very   
                              efficient. However, element quality is  
                              poor.                                   
                              If mpp = 2 then use advancing-front     
                              point placement. The produces optimal   
                              element quality.                        
 
1         0         1         mqrgen                  
                              Quality improvement re-generation flag. 
                              If mqrgen = 1 then low-quality regions  
                              of the grid will be re-generated.       
                              If mqrgen = 0 then do not re-generate   
                              any part of the grid.                   
 
0         0         1         mrecbdw                 
                              Boundary curvature reconnection flag.   
                              Applies to the initial boundary surface 
                              grid only.                              
                              If mrecbdw = 0 then do not reconnect    
                              initial boundary surface to improve     
                              curvature matching.                     
                              If mrecbdw = 1 then reconnect initial   
                              boundary surface to improve curvature   
                              matching.                               
                              This option is not applicable if        
                              boundary face reconnection is turned    
                              off (mrecbm=0).                         
 
0         -2        2         mrecbm                  
                              Boundary face local-reconnection flag.  
                              Applies to the initial boundary surface 
                              grid only.                              
                              If mrecbm = 0 then do not reconnect     
                              initial boundary surface.               
                              If mrecbm = 1 then use a MAX-MIN-Angle  
                              criterion if the boundary surface is    
                              considered low-quality (see angqbfm).   
                              If mrecbm = 2 then use a MIN-MAX-Angle  
                              criterion if the boundary surface is    
                              considered low-quality (see angqbfm).   
                              If mrecbm = -1 then use a MAX-MIN-Angle 
                              criterion without check quality first.  
                              If mrecbm = 2 then use a MIN-MAX-Angle  
                              criterion without check quality first.  
 
3         2         3         mreciqm                 
                              Initial quality local-reconnection flag.
                              If mreciqm = 2 then use a combined      
                              Delaunay and MIN-MAX-Angle criterion.   
                              If mreciqm = 3 then use a combined      
                              Delaunay and MAX-MIN-Rratio criterion.  
 
2         1         3         mrecm                   
                              Local-Reconnection flag.                
                              If mrecm = 1 then use a Delaunay        
                              criterion.                              
                              If mrecm = 2 then use a combined        
                              Delaunay and MIN-MAX-Angle criterion.   
                              If mrecm = 3 then use a combined        
                              Delaunay and MAX-MIN-Rratio criterion.  
                              This option typically results in a      
                              slightly improved grid quality at the   
                              expense of an increase in required CPU  
                              time.                                   
 
2         2         3         mrecqm                  
                              Quality local-reconnection flag.        
                              Applies to all but the last pass of     
                              quality improvement.                    
                              If mrecqm = 2 then use a combined       
                              Delaunay and MIN-MAX-Angle criterion.   
                              If mrecqm = 3 then use a combined       
                              Delaunay and MAX-MIN-Rratio criterion.  
                              This option typically results in a      
                              slightly improved grid quality at the   
                              expense of an increase in required CPU  
                              time.                                   
 
3         2         3         mrecqmf                 
                              Final quality local-reconnection flag.  
                              Applies only to the last pass of quality
                              improvement.                            
                              If mrecqmf = 2 then use a combined      
                              Delaunay and MIN-MAX-Angle criterion.   
                              If mrecqmf = 3 then use a combined      
                              Delaunay and MAX-MIN-Rratio criterion.  
 
1         0         1         mrecrbf                 
                              Global boundary face reconnection flag. 
                              If mrecbf = 1 then allow reconnection of
                              boundary surface faces dependent upon   
                              the input grid boundary surface face    
                              reconnection flag.                      
                              If mrecbf = 0 then turn off all         
                              reconnection of boundary surface faces  
                              regardless of input grid boundary       
                              surface face reconnection flag.         
 
0         0         3         msetbc                  
                              Set grid boundary condition flag option.
                              If msetbc = 0 then do not change the    
                              input grid boundary condition flag.     
                              If msetbc = 1, 2, or 3 and a surface has
                              at least one edge that is free then     
                              automatically set the grid boundary     
                              condition flag for that surface to an   
                              embedded/transparent surface. An        
                              embedded surface is defined as a set of 
                              connected faces that have one or more   
                              open outer edges and any other outer    
                              edges connected to one or more faces of 
                              another surface.                        
                              If msetbc = 2 then the surfaces         
                              identified as embedded/transparent will 
                              be converted to source nodes.           
                              If msetbc = 3 then the surfaces         
                              identified as embedded/transparent will 
                              be converted to internal faces and not  
                              included in the output boundary surface 
                              definition (connectivity, ID, etc).     
                              Also, if msetbc = 1, 2, or 3 then check 
                              for planar surfaces that are not        
                              BL/SL/SNS generating surfaces and       
                              automatically set the grid boundary     
                              condition flag for them to that for an  
                              intersecting surface. A planar surface  
                              is defined as a set of connected faces  
                              with the same surface normal vector     
                              (within the maximum normal deviation    
                              angblipmax), a total number of faces    
                              greater than or equal to nsetblip, and  
                              at least one outer edge that is adjacent
                              to a BL/SL/SNS generating face.         
 
1         0         2         msource                 
                              Source option flag.                     
                              If msource = 0 then do not use sources. 
                              If msource = 1 and there are sources    
                              then insert the sources into the initial
                              grid.                                   
                              If msource = 2 and there are sources    
                              then create a source node grid for      
                              interpolating the local distribution    
                              function and transformation metric (if  
                              mtr >= 1) during grid generation.       
                              Sources can be set by input data and/or 
                              created from source type transparent/   
                              embedded boundary surface faces. Sources
                              modify the point distribution function  
                              and transformation metric (if mtr >= 1) 
                              and the resulting element size and shape
                              in the region near a source node. This  
                              option has no effect if there are no    
                              sources nodes.                          
 
0         0         2         mtr                     
                              Spacing transformation flag.            
                              If mtr = 0 then do not use a local      
                              transformation.                         
                              If mtr = 1 then use a local             
                              transformation with transformation      
                              vectors from sources (if msource>=1) and
                              boundaries (if mtrb=1).                 
                              If mtr = 2 then use a local             
                              transformation with transformation      
                              vectors from sources (if msource>=1)    
                              and/or boundaries (if mtrb=1) along with
                              geometric growth defined by parameters  
                              cdfrsrc and cdfssrc.                    
 
0         0         1         mtrsrcb                 
                              Anisotropic aspect-ratio blending flag. 
                              If mtrsrcb = 0 then do not use          
                              aniostropic to isotropic aspect-ratio   
                              blending.                               
                              If mtrsrcb = 1 then use anisotropic to  
                              isotropic aspect-ratio blending.        
                              Anisotropic transformation vectors are  
                              created to blend from anisotropic       
                              aspect-ratio boundary surface elements  
                              to isotropic field elements. Sources are
                              created as needed for the transformation
                              vectors and the spacing transformation  
                              flag is set to mtr = 2.                 
 
0         -3        5         mtransp                 
                              Transparent B-face flag.                
                              Normally all source-type transparent/   
                              embedded B-faces with a BC flag of 3 are
                              converted to source nodes, all standard 
                              transparent/embedded B-faces with a BC  
                              flag of 5 are included in the output    
                              grid as B-faces, and all internal-type  
                              transparent/embedded B-faces with a BC  
                              flag of 6 are included in the grid      
                              throughout grid generation and then     
                              the B-face connectivity (not the        
                              coordinates) is removed from the output 
                              grid.                                   
                              If mtransp = 0 then do not change any BC
                              flags and treat all transparent/embedded
                              B-faces normally.                       
                              If mtransp = 1 then convert all source- 
                              type transparent/embedded B-faces with a
                              BC flag of 3 to standard transparent/   
                              embedded B-faces with a BC flag of 5.   
                              If mtransp = 2 then convert all source- 
                              type transparent/embedded B-faces with a
                              BC flag of 3 to internal-type           
                              transparent/embedded B-faces with a BC  
                              flag of 6.                              
                              If mtransp = 3 then convert all source- 
                              type or internal-type transparent/      
                              embedded B-faces with a BC flag of 3 or 
                              6 to standard transparent/embedded B-   
                              faces with a BC flag of 5.              
                              If mtransp = 4 then convert all source- 
                              type or standard transparent/embedded   
                              B-faces with a BC flag of 3 or 5 to     
                              internal-type transparent/embedded      
                              B-faces with a BC flag of 6.            
                              If mtransp = 5 then delete all source-  
                              type, standard, or internal-type        
                              transparent/embedded B-faces with a BC  
                              flag of 3, 4, or 5.                     
                              If mtransp = -1 then convert standard   
                              transparent/embedded B-faces with a BC  
                              flag of 5 to source-type transparent/   
                              embedded B-faces with a BC flag of 3.   
                              If mtransp = -2 then convert internal-  
                              type transparent/embedded B-faces with a
                              flag of 6 to source-type transparent/   
                              embedded B-faces with a BC flag of 3.   
                              If mtransp = -3 then convert standard   
                              and internal-type transparent/embedded  
                              B-faces with a BC flag of 5 or 6 to     
                              source-type transparent/embedded B-faces
                              with a BC flag of 3.                    
 
0         0         1         mwbcsurf                
                              BC surface file flag.                   
                              If mwbcsurf = 0 then do not write       
                              boundary surface grid file after setting
                              boundary conditions                     
                              If mwbcsurf = 1 then write boundary     
                              surface grid file after setting boundary
                              conditions.                             
                              Only applicable if the grid boundary    
                              condition flag option is on (msetbc=1). 
 
1         0         1         mwfail                  
                              Temporary surface FAIL file flag.       
                              If mwfail = 0 then do not write         
                              temporary boundary surface FAIL files.  
                              If mwfail = 1 then write temporary      
                              boundary surface FAIL files. Temporary  
                              boundary surface FAIL files are exactly 
                              the same as the boundary surface FAIL   
                              file written after a fatal boundary     
                              surface grid error except that they are 
                              written out prior to attempting         
                              high-risk boundary surface face recovery
                              procedures. After completion of the     
                              procedure they are removed.             
 
0         0         1         mwvnode                 
                              VNODE node data file flag.              
                              If mwvnode = 0 then do not write VNODE  
                              source node data file.                  
                              If mwblsurf = 1 then write VNODE source 
                              node data file if there are source nodes.
 
4         0         10000000  ninlpp                  
                              Initial centroid point placement passes.
                              During grid generation large elements   
                              that have all edges larger than the     
                              distribution function (local point      
                              spacing) are subdivided using centroid  
                              point placement. This is repeated for   
                              ninlpp passes or less if there are no   
                              elements to subdivide. Standard point   
                              placement (as specified by mpp) is then 
                              used. Only applicable if initial        
                              centroid point placement is on          
                              (minlpp=1).                             
 
*         *         *         Rec_IDs                 
                              List of IDs to reset Reconnection flag. 
                              If the Rec_IDs parameter vector is set  
                              then the reconnection flag is set to on,
                              allowing reconnection in all directions,
                              for all faces with a surface ID in the  
                              vector and it is set to off, allowing no
                              reconnection, for all faces with a      
                              surface ID not in the vector.           
                              For example, if Rec_IDs is set to the   
                              vector 3,3,5,6 then there are 3 vector  
                              entries and all faces with surface IDs  
                              3, 5, or 6 will be turned on and all    
                              others will be turned off.              
 
0         0         1         mpartm                  
                              Partition flag.                         
                              If mpartm = 0 then use standard grid    
                              generation mode.                        
                              If mpartm = 1 then use partition mode   
                              to minimize memory requirements for grid
                              generation and/or enable parallel mode. 
 
2         0         3         mpfrmt                  
                              Partition mode output grid file format. 
                              In partition mode the final output grid 
                              grid is written to a file by routines   
                              that use temporary files to minimize    
                              memory requirements instead of standard 
                              UG_IO routines.                         
 
0         0         2         mwpgrid                 
                              Partition grid debug file flag.         
                              If mwpgrid = 0 then do not write        
                              components of partition grid to grid    
                              files.                                  
                              If mwpgrid >= 1 then write finished and 
                              unfinished components of partition grid 
                              to type UGRID grid files.               
                              If mwpgrid = 1 then write grid files    
                              using formatted ASCII.                  
                              If mwpgrid = 2 then write grid files    
                              using unformatted binary with           
                              floating-point doubles.                 
                              Only applicable if partition mode option
                              is on (mpartm=1) and more than one      
                              partition is requested (npart>1).       
 
4         0         10000000  nlsrpp                  
                              Maximum LSR point placement passes.     
                              Initial length scale reduction point    
                              placement is used for initial elements  
                              that have length scales smaller than    
                              lsrpplim. Normal point placement is used
                              after the initial element length scales 
                              are reduced or after nlsrpp passes.     
                              Only applicable if partition mode option
                              is on (mpartm=1) and more than one      
                              partition is requested (npart>1).       
 
1         1         1000000   npart                   
                              Number of partitions.                   
                              In partition mode (mpartm=1) the number 
                              partitions that the initial grid is     
                              partitioned into is the greater of npart
                              or the number of processors. Additional 
                              partitions will be added to satisfy the 
                              maximum number of elements, npelem.     
                              Only applicable if partition mode option
                              is on (mpartm=1).                       
 
0         0         2000000000npelmax                 
                              Max. number of elements per partition.  
                              If npelmax > 0 and partition mode is on 
                              (mpartm=1) the initial grid is          
                              partitioned and the maximum number of   
                              elements within a partition is limited  
                              to be less than npelmax.                
                              If npelmax = 0 then there is no limit on
                              the number of elements within a         
                              partition.                              
                              Only applicable if partition mode option
                              is on (mpartm=1) and more than one      
                              partition is requested (npart>1).       
 
10000     0         2000000000npelmin                 
                              Min. number of elements per partition.  
                              If npelemin > 0 and partition mode is on
                              (mpartm=1) the initial grid is          
                              partitioned and the minimum number of   
                              elements within a partition is limited  
                              to be at least npelmin.                 
                              If npelmin = 0 then there is no limit on
                              the minimum number of elements within a 
                              partition.                              
                              Only applicable if partition mode option
                              is on (mpartm=1) and more than one      
                              partition is requested (npart>1).       
 
0         -1        2         mbl                     
                              BL grid flag.                           
                              If mbl = 0 then generate a standard     
                              isotropic element grid.                 
                              If mbl = -1 then generate layers using  
                              specified normal spacing (SNS) next to  
                              all boundary faces with a grid boundary 
                              condition that is less than zero. In    
                              this case the normal spacing            
                              distribution is specified by the        
                              parameter SNS and surface IDs for the   
                              normal spacing groups are specified by  
                              the parameter SNS_IDs.                  
                              If mbl = 1 then generate a CFD type BL  
                              grid next to all boundary faces with a  
                              grid boundary condition that is less    
                              than zero. In this case the initial     
                              normal spacing must be specified.       
                              If mbl = 2 then generate a structured-  
                              layer (SL) grid next to all boundary    
                              faces with a grid boundary condition    
                              that is less than zero. In this case the
                              initial normal spacing is equal to a    
                              fraction of the tangential spacing on   
                              the boundary surface.                   
 
0         0         1         mblauto                 
                              BL auto-parameter flag.                 
                              Determines whether the calculated BL    
                              growth rate parameters for turbulent    
                              flow are used when mbltype=2.           
                              If mblauto = 0 then set the BL growth   
                              rate parameters explicityly.            
                              If mblauto = 1 then set the BL growth   
                              rate parameters automatically.          
                              Only applicable if the CFD BL flag is on
                              (mbl=1) and the BL type flag is on      
                              (mbltype>=1).                           
 
0         0         1         mblchki                 
                              BL parameter and surface check flag.    
                              If mblchki = 0 then perform normal grid 
                              generation.                             
                              If mblchki = 1 then check BL parameters 
                              and input surface grid, output BL       
                              parameters after automatic calculation, 
                              and exit without generating a volume    
                              grid. Only applicable if the CFD BL flag
                              is on (mbl=1).                          
 
0         0         1         mbldelmax               
                              BL thickness flag.                      
                              The BL thickness can be set equal to the
                              maximum BL thickness required for the   
                              entire BL region to reach maximum normal
                              spacing.                                
                              If mbldelmax=0 then the BL thickness is 
                              not set based on the maximum BL         
                              thickness.                              
                              If mbldelmax=1 then the BL thickness is 
                              set based on the maximum BL thickness.  
 
0         0         2         mblelc                  
                              BL element combination flag.            
                              If mblelc = 0 then do not combine       
                              elements in BL region.                  
                              If mblelc = 1 then combine elements in  
                              BL region to form pentahedra with five  
                              nodes (pyramid) or six nodes (prism).   
                              If mblelc = 2 then combine elements in  
                              BL region to form pentahedra with five  
                              nodes (pyramid) or six nodes (prism)    
                              and hexahedra. Note that hexahedra will 
                              only be formed if the surface with the  
                              attached BL region contains quad faces  
                              Also, the interface between the hexs and
                              isotropic tet region will have split    
                              faces (one hex face matching up to two  
                              or more tets. Only applicable if the    
                              B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).          
 
2         0         2         mblend                  
                              BL termination flag.                    
                              If mblend = 0 then do not globally      
                              terminate BL advancement.               
                              If mblend = 1 then globally terminate BL
                              advancement if the global termination   
                              criteria for BL thickness and normal-   
                              direction-aspect-ratio are met (see     
                              cblend and cblnrendm).                  
                              If mblend = 2 then globally terminate BL
                              advancement if the global termination   
                              as with mblend=1 or if all of the active
                              BL nodes have normal-direction-aspect   
                              ratios at the limit defined by cblmnr.  
                              Only appl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is
                              on (mbl!=0).                            
 
0         0         1         mblfinal                
                              BL final layer flag.                    
                              Determines if final BL region layer is  
                              turned off to provide for space for     
                              isotropic region.                       
                              If mblfinal = 0 then leave final BL     
                              region layer alone.                     
                              If mblfinal = 1 then turn off final BL  
                              region layer. Only applicable if the    
                              B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).          
 
0         0         1         mblidsmth               
                              BL surface ID smoothing flag.           
                              If mblidsmth = 1 then smooth initial    
                              normal spacing and BL thickness across  
                              surface faces with differing surface ID.
                              If mblidsmth = 0 then do not smooth     
                              initial normal spacing and BL thickness.
                              Only applicable if the CFD BL flag is on
                              (mbl=1).                                
 
0         0         1         mblreseti               
                              BL initial normal spacing reset flag.   
                              If mblreseti = 0 then do not modify     
                              initial normal spacing or BL thickness  
                              values set in the input arrays (or set  
                              by the input surface grid file).        
                              If mblreseti = 1 then reset the initial 
                              normal spacing and/or BL thickness      
                              values set in the input arrays (or set  
                              by the input surface grid file) with    
                              those determined from the BL parameter  
                              values (such as blyp, dsdef, deldef,    
                              etc).                                   
                              Only applicable if the CFD BL flag is on
                              (mbl=1).                                
 
2         0         2         mbltype                 
                              BL type flag.                           
                              Determines whether the BL spacing       
                              parameters are calculated from either a 
                              laminar or turbulent flat plate         
                              approximation or set from input         
                              parameters.                             
                              If mbltype = 0 then do not change input 
                              BL spacing parameters.                  
                              If mbltype = 1 then determine BL spacing
                              parameters based on a laminar flat plate
                              approximation.                          
                              If mbltype = 2 then determine BL spacing
                              parameters based on a turbulent flat    
                              plate approximation.                    
                              Only applicable if the CFD BL flag is on
                              (mbl=1).                                
 
0         0         1         mdfb                    
                              BL interface distribution function flag.
                              If mdfb = 0 then determine length scales
                              for the distribution function from the  
                              interface surface between BL and        
                              isotropic regions.                      
                              If mdfb = 1 then determine length scales
                              for the distribution function from the  
                              minimum length scale of the interface   
                              surface between BL and isotropic regions
                              and of the initial boundary surface.    
 
0         0         1         mdfblminm               
                              BL isotropic length scale limiting flag.
                              The isotropic length scaled used to     
                              determine the maximum normal BL spacing 
                              is set to the minimum local isotropic   
                              spacing on the boundary surface. This   
                              length scale can be limited by the      
                              corresponding minimum isotropic spacing 
                              on the BL interface surface as the BL   
                              grid is generated. For concave regions  
                              this prevents the normal spacing from   
                              growing larger than the local isotropic 
                              spacing.                                
                              If mdfblminm = 1 then limit the length  
                              scale.                                  
                              If mdfblminm = 0 then do not limit the  
                              length scale.                           
 
1         0         2         mdsblf                  
                              BL spacing thickness factor option.     
                              The normal spacing is multiplied by a   
                              computed factor between one and dsblfmax
                              at all nodes to attempt and keep the    
                              layer thickness constant on surrounding 
                              boundary faces.                         
                              If mdsblf = 0 then the factor is set to 
                              one at all points.                      
                              If mdsblf = 1 then the factor is set to 
                              the computed factor multiplied by a     
                              weighted smoothing coefficient that     
                              varies from one at concave points to    
                              zero at convex points and that is based 
                              on the number of BL concave region      
                              smoothing layers, nblsmthl, that varies 
                              from one at concave points to zero at   
                              convex points.                          
                              If mdsblf = 2 then the factor is set to 
                              the computed factor. This option will   
                              produce the the most constant layer     
                              thickness (with a possible degredation  
                              in element quality). Only applicable if 
                              the B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).      
 
0         0         1         mopen                   
                              Open grid generation domain flag.       
                              The grid generation domain is usually   
                              closed, and must be for isotropic grid  
                              generation. However, a BL only grid can 
                              be generated in an open domain with the 
                              domain being from the surface to the end
                              of the BL region.                       
                              If mopen = 1 then generate BL only grid 
                              in an open domain.                      
                              If mopen = 0 then generate a BL and     
                              isotropic element grid in a closed      
                              domain.                                 
                              Only appl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ag   
                              is on (mbl!=0).                         
 
0         0         1         mrevbl                  
                              BL normal direction flag.               
                              With an open grid generation domain     
                              (mopen=1) the direction of the BL       
                              normals is always out from a closed.    
                              body. With an open surface the          
                              orientation may change from the input if
                              any surface face connectivity reordering
                              is required. In either case the         
                              direction can be changed with the BL    
                              normal direction flag.                  
                              If mrevbl = 1 then reverse direction of 
                              BL normals.                             
                              If mrevbl = 0 then do change BL normals.
                              Only appl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ag   
                              is on (mbl!=0) and the open grid        
                              generation domain flag is on (mopen=1). 
 
1         0         1         msetabl                 
                              Set adjacent surface to BL flag.        
                              Determines if non-BL surfaces adjacent  
                              to a BL surface and another non-BL      
                              surface are reset to be blended BL      
                              surfaces. On a blended BL surface the   
                              initial normal spacing is smoothly      
                              increased up to the isotropic spacing.  
                              If msetabl = 1 then any non-BL surface  
                              (defined by surface ID) will be set to a
                              blended BL surface if it is adjacent to 
                              a BL surface and also a non-BL surface. 
                              If msetabl = 0 then no surfaces are     
                              reset.                                  
                              Only applicable if the CFD BL flag is on
                              (mbl=1).                                
 
0         0         1         mwblfunc                
                              BL level function file flag.            
                              If mwblfunc = 0 then do not write BL    
                              level function file.                    
                              If mwblfunc = 1 then write BL level     
                              function file and a corresponding       
                              surface grid file.                      
                              The BL level function file contains a   
                              function value for every boundary node  
                              that corresponds to the number of BL    
                              levels generated for the node. The files
                              will named case_name.BLF.ufunc and      
                              case_name.BLF.surf. Only applicable if  
                              the B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).      
 
0         0         1         mwblsdfunc              
                              BL surf. discontinuity funct. file flag.
                              If mwblsdfunc = 0 then do not write BL  
                              surface discontinuity function file.    
                              If mwblsdfunc = 1 then write BL level   
                              surface discontinuity function file and 
                              a corresponding surface grid file.      
                              The files will named                    
                              case_name.BLSDF.ufunc and               
                              case_name.BLSDF.surf. Only applicable if
                              the B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).      
 
0         0         1         mwblsurf                
                              BL surface file flag.                   
                              If mwblsurf = 0 then do not write BL    
                              boundary surface grid file.             
                              If mwblsurf = 1 then write BL boundary  
                              surface grid file.                      
                              The BL boundary surface grid file       
                              contains the inflated BL surfaces along 
                              the B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).      
                              boundary surface grid file will be named
                              case_name.BL.surf. Only applicable if   
 
5         0         1000      iblri                   
                              Number of constant spacing BL layers.   
                              The node distribution normal to the     
                              boundary surface within a CFD BL grid   
                              has iblri layers that use a constant    
                              growth rate, cdfrbl. After iblri layers 
                              the growth rate increases at an         
                              acceleration rate equal to dcdfrbl. If  
                              the BL auto-parameter flag is on        
                              (mblauto=1) then iblri is calculated    
                              internally along with cdfrbl and        
                              dcdfrbl. Only applicable if the CFD BL  
                              flag is on (mbl=1).                     
 
10000     0         10000000  nbl                     
                              Maximum BL grid layers to generate.     
                              Only appl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is
                              on (mbl!=0).                            
 
0         0         10000000  nbldiff                 
                              Maximum difference in BL levels.        
                              If nbldiff > 0 then the maximum         
                              difference between the number of BL     
                              levels for the BL nodes on a given BL   
                              boundary surface face is limited to     
                              nbldiff. Any active BL node that would  
                              allow the number of levels to be greater
                              is terminated.                          
                              If nbldiff = 0 then the difference in BL
                              levels is ignored.                      
                              Only applicable if the SNS BL flag is   
                              on (mbl=-1).                            
                              Only applicable if the CFD BL flag is   
                              on (mbl=1).                             
 
5         2         10000000  nblidsmthl              
                              BL surface ID smoothing layers.         
                              Number of surface face layers within a  
                              group/patch of surface faces with the   
                              same surface ID. If mblidsmth = 1 then  
                              the initial normal spacing and BL       
                              thickness across surface faces with     
                              differing surface ID are smoothed. Only 
                              applicable if the CFD BL flag is on     
                              (mbl=1).                                
 
20        0         10000     nblsmth                 
                              BL normal vector smoothing iterations.  
                              BL normal vectors are smoothed nblsmth  
                              iterations. Only applicable if the      
                              B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).          
 
10        0         10000     nblsmthl                
                              BL concave region smoothing layers.     
                              BL normal vectors near concave regions  
                              are smoothed over nblsmthl layers of    
                              adjacent boundary surface faces. This is
                              in addition to normal normal vector     
                              smoothing. The concave region smoothing 
                              layers are also used to determine a     
                              weighted smoothing coefficient for the  
                              BL spacing thickness factor (see        
                              mdsblf). Only applicable if the         
                              B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).          
 
0         0         10000000  npsurf                  
                              Number of periodic surface pairs.       
                              For each periodic surface pair the      
                              parent and child surface IDs must be    
                              specified in the list of periodic       
                              surface IDs, PS_IDs. For each parent    
                              both the translation vector, PS_XPS0s,  
                              and rotation matrix, PS_TMs, must be    
                              specified. The input surface grid must  
                              be periodic if specified to be. The     
                              output surface grid will maintain the   
                              periodic properties specified. Note that
                              the specified periodic parent and child 
                              surfaces must also have a surface grid  
                              BC for a surface that intersects the BL 
                              region and is rebuilt to match. Only    
                              appl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is on  
                              (mbl!=0).                               
 
3         1         100       nsblm                   
                              SL normal vector smoothing layers.      
                              The boundary normal vectors are smoothed
                              over nsblm layers. The initial smoothing
                              is zero and increases to full smoothing 
                              by layer nsblm. Only applicable if the  
                              SL flag is on (mbl=2).                  
 
4         1         99999999  nsetblip                
                              Minimum number of faces on a BL plane.  
                              Only applicable if the automatic        
                              boundary condition option is on         
                              (msetbc=1) and the BL/SL/SNS flag is on 
                              (mbl!=0).                               
 
0         0         1         Write_BL_Only           
                              BL element output flag.                 
                              If Write_BL_Only = 0 then output all    
                              elements.                               
                              If Write_BL_Only = 1 then output only BL
                              elements.                               
 
*         *         *         BL_IDs                  
                              List of IDs to reset grid BL flag.      
                              If the vector BL_IDs is set then the    
                              grid boundary condition flag is set to a
                              negative value, specifying BL grid      
                              generation, for all faces with a surface
                              ID in the list and it is set to a       
                              positive value, specifying no BL grid   
                              generation, for all faces with a surface
                              ID not in the list. For example, if the 
                              vector BL_IDs is set to 3,2,5,6 then    
                              there are 3 entries in the vector and   
                              all faces with surface IDs 2, 5 or 6    
                              will have BL grid generation and all    
                              B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).          
 
*         *         *         BLG_IDs                 
                              List of IDs for BL groups.              
                              If the vector BLG_IDs is set then a     
                              group ID is set for all faces with a    
                              surface ID in the list and all others   
                              are not given a group ID. Each group    
                              will be treated as if it has an         
                              independent BL. Streamwise variation    
                              will be determined for each group.      
                              independently. The vector BLG_IDs is    
                              composed of the sub-lists of IDs for all
                              groups. Each sub-list is preceeded by   
                              the number of IDs within the given      
                              group. For example, if the vector       
                              BLG_IDs is set to 9,2,3,5,3,6,2,4,1,9   
                              then there are 9 entries in the vector, 
                              2 entries for group 1, 3 entries for    
                              group 2, and 1 entry for group 3. All   
                              faces with surface IDs 3 and 5 will be  
                              set to group 1, all faces with surface  
                              IDs 6, 2 and 4 will be set to group 2   
                              and all faces with surface ID 9 will be 
                              set to group 3. Only applicable if the  
                              CFD BL flag is on (mbl=1) and the flow  
                              direction vector is specified           
                              (|vx,vy,vz| > 0).                       
 
*         *         *         Int_IDs                 
                              List of IDs for intersecting surfaces.  
                              If the vector Int_IDs is set then the   
                              grid boundary condition flag is set to a
                              value of two, specifying an intersecting
                              surface, for all faces with a surface ID
                              in the list and it is set to a magnitude
                              of one, specifying a non-intersecting   
                              surface, for all faces with a surface ID
                              not in the list. The surface grid will  
                              be regenerated with an intersecting     
                              BL for all intersecting surfaces that   
                              are adjacent to a BL surface. For       
                              example, if the vector Int_IDs is set to
                              3,3,5,6 then there are 3 entries in the 
                              vector and all faces with surface IDs 3,
                              5 or 6 will set to intersecting surfaces
                              and all others will not. Only applicable
                              if the B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).   
 
*         *         *         PS_IDs                  
                              List of IDs for periodic surfaces.      
                              For each periodic surface pair the      
                              parent and child surface IDs must be    
                              specified in the list of periodic       
                              surface IDs, PS_IDs. The list PS_IDs    
                              contains the total number of periodic   
                              surface IDs followed by the list of IDs 
                              for each parent and child surface. For  
                              example, if the list PS_IDs is set to   
                              4,7,4,12,2 then there are 4 entries in  
                              the vector (must be an even number) and 
                              two periodic surface pairs. The first   
                              pair includes the surface faces with IDs
                              7,4 and the second includes the surface 
                              faces with IDs 12,2. Only applicable if 
                              the B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).      
 
*         *         *         SNS_IDs                 
                              List of specified spacing groups IDs.   
                              If the vector SNS_IDs is set along with 
                              the normal spacing vector SNS then the  
                              group ID for each normal spacing group  
                              is set. Otherwise only one normal       
                              spacing group that contains all surface 
                              IDs is assumed. The number of normal    
                              spacing groups must be the same for both
                              vectors SNS_IDs and SNS. The vector     
                              SNS_IDs is composed of the sub-lists of 
                              IDs for all groups. Each sub-list is    
                              preceeded by the number of IDs within   
                              the given group. For example, if the    
                              vector SNS_IDs is set to 7,2,3,5,3,6,2,4
                              then there are 7 entries in the vector  
                              and two groups. All faces with surface  
                              IDs 3 and 5 will be part of group 1 and 
                              all faces with surface IDs 6, 2 and 4   
                              will be part of group 2. Only applicable
                              if the SNS flag is on (mbl=-1).         
 
1         0         15        GQ_Vol_Measure_Flag     
                              Volume grid quality measure flag.       
                              If GQ_Vol_Measure_Flag = 0 then do not  
                              generate volume quality measures.       
                              If GQ_Vol_Measure_Flag > 0 then generate
                              volume quality measures.                
                              The value of GQ_Vol_Measure_Flag        
                              determines which measures are computed. 
                              The appropriate value of                
                              GQ_Vol_Measure_Flag  is obtained from   
                              -                                       
                                 GQ_Vol_Measure_Flag =     Flag_0     
                                                     + 2 * Flag_1     
                                                     + 4 * Flag_2     
                                                     + 8 * Flag_3     
                              -                                       
                              Flag_# (# = 0, 1, 2, or 3) are either 0 
                              or 1. If Flag_# = 0 then that measure   
                              is not computed. If Flag_# = 1 then     
                              that measure is computed. The quality   
                              measures corresponding to # are         
                              -                                       
                                 0 : Dihedral Element Angle           
                                     An ideal element has dihedral    
                                     element angles near 70.5 deg. A  
                                     low quality element has an angle 
                                     near 180 deg.                    
                                 1 : Radius Ratio (3*Ri/Rc)           
                                     An ideal element has a radius    
                                     ratio of 1. A low quality element
                                     has a ratio near 0.              
                                 2 : Volume Ratio (C21*Vol/Rc**3)     
                                     An ideal element has a volume    
                                     ratio of 1. A low quality element
                                     has a ratio near 0.              
                                 3 : Length Ratio (C31*Ri/Lmax)       
                                     An ideal element has a length    
                                     ratio of 1. A low quality element
                                     has a ratio near 0.              
                              -                                       
                              where                                   
                              -                                       
                                 Rc   = Circumscribed Radius          
                                 Ri   = Inscribed Radius              
                                 Vol  = Element Volume                
                                 Lmax = Maximum Element Edge Length   
                                 C21  = 1.948557                      
                                 C31  = 4.898979                      
                              -                                       
                              This is a UG_GQ LIB parameter.          
 
1         0         1         GQ_Vol_Output_Flag      
                              Volume grid quality output flag.        
                              If GQ_Vol_Output_Flag = 0 then do not   
                              create grid quality output file(s).     
                              If GQ_Vol_Output_Flag = 1 then create   
                              grid quality output file(s). An output  
                              file is created for each measure if     
                              GQ_Vol_Output_Flag = 1. Each file       
                              contains quality statistics and         
                              distribution data for plotting.         
                              This is a UG_GQ LIB parameter.          
 
0         0         15        GQ_Surf_Measure_Flag    
                              Surface grid quality measure flag.      
                              If GQ_Surf_Measure_Flag = 0 then do not 
                              generate surface quality measures.      
                              If GQ_Surf_Measure_Flag > 0 then        
                              generate surface quality measures.      
                              The value of GQ_Surf_Measure_Flag       
                              determines which measures are computed. 
                              The appropriate value of                
                              GQ_Surf_Measure_Flag is obtained from   
                              -                                       
                                 GQ_Surf_Measure_Flag =     Flag_0    
                                                      + 2 * Flag_1    
                                                      + 4 * Flag_2    
                                                      + 8 * Flag_3    
                              -                                       
                              Flag_# (# = 0, 1, 2, or 3) are either 0 
                              or 1. If Flag_# = 0 then that measure   
                              is not computed. If Flag_# = 1 then that
                              measure is computed. The quality        
                              measures corresponding to # are         
                              -                                       
                                 0 : Boundary Face Angle              
                                     An ideal face has boundary face  
                                     angles near 60 deg. A low quality
                                     face has an angle near 180 deg.  
                                 1 : Radius Ratio (2*Ri/Rc)           
                                     An ideal face has a radius ratio 
                                     of 1. A low quality face has a   
                                     ratio near 0.                    
                                 2 : Area Ratio (C22*Area/Rc**2)      
                                     An ideal face has an area ratio  
                                     of 1. A low quality face has a   
                                     near 0.                          
                                 3 : Length Ratio (C32*Ri/Lmax)       
                                     An ideal face has a length ratio 
                                     of 1. A low quality face has a   
                                     ratio near 0.                    
                              -                                       
                              where                                   
                              -                                       
                                 Rc   = Circumscribed Radius          
                                 Ri   = Inscribed Radius              
                                 Area = Face Area                     
                                 Lmax = Maximum Face Edge Length      
                                 C22  = 0.384900                      
                                 C32  = 3.464102                      
                              -                                       
                              This is a UG_GQ LIB parameter.          
 
1         0         1         GQ_Surf_Output_Flag     
                              Surface grid quality output flag.       
                              If GQ_Surf_Output_Flag = 0 then do not  
                              create grid quality output file(s).     
                              If GQ_Surf_Output_Flag = 1 then create  
                              grid quality output file(s). An output  
                              file is created for each measure if     
                              GQ_Surf_Output_Flag = 1. Each file      
                              contains quality statistics and         
                              distribution data for plotting.         
                              This is a UG_GQ LIB parameter.          
 
1.2       0.1       1e+06     cdf                     
                              Distribution function multiplier.       
                              The distribution function is used to    
                              specify desired element size. The       
                              distribution function originally        
                              determined from the average of the      
                              surrounding boundary edge lengths is    
                              multiplied by cdf. Increasing cdf will  
                              increase the total number of grid nodes 
                              generated. Decreasing cdf will decrease 
                              the total number of grid nodes          
                              generated. Deviation of cdf far from a  
                              value of 1.0 will degrade the element   
                              quality next to the boundaries. A cdf   
                              value above 1.0 will create elements    
                              adjacent to boundaries that are         
                              elongated normal to the boundary. In    
                              the rest of the field the elements      
                              should be relatively isotropic.         
 
1         0.1       1e+06     cdf_vol                 
                              Distribution function multp (vol mesh). 
                              If the initial mesh is a volume mesh    
                              then the distribution function          
                              multiplier, cdf, is replaced with the   
                              volume mesh value, cdf_vol. Not         
                              applicable if the initial mesh is a     
                              boundary surface mesh.                  
 
0         0         1         cdfm                    
                              Distribution function weighting factor. 
                              The node distribution function for new  
                              nodes is averaged with the minimum      
                              nearby node distribution functions. This
                              factor is the weighting for the minimum 
                              contribution. Increasing cdfm above 0.0 
                              will in general reduce the growth of    
                              element size from small to larger       
                              elements and increase the total number  
                              of grid nodes generated. It will have   
                              little or no effect if all the boundary 
                              surface triangles are nearly the same   
                              size.                                   
 
1.1       1         3         cdfr                    
                              Maximum geometric growth rate.          
                              Used as the advancing-front growth      
                              limit. The element size for new nodes is
                              limited to be less than the physical    
                              size of the face advanced from          
                              multiplied by cdfr. Also used as the    
                              geometric growth rate for the node      
                              distribution function with the growth   
                              option (mdf=2). A cdfr value just above 
                              1.0 will produce a grid with optimal    
                              element quality. A value of cdfr well   
                              above a value of 1.0 will decrease the  
                              number of grid nodes generated and      
                              potentially decrease the element        
                              quality.                                
 
1.2       1         3         cdfrsrc                 
                              Maximum geometric source growth rate.   
                              Used as the geometric growth rate for   
                              the node distribution function and      
                              transformation vector magnitude (mtr>=1)
                              from sources. Only applicable if the    
                              source option flag and source node grid 
                              options are on (msource=2) or the       
                              transformation growth option flag is on 
                              (mtr=2).                                
 
1         0         3         cdfs                    
                              Distribution function exclusion zone.   
                              Distribution function growth exclusion  
                              zone factor used with growth option     
                              (mdf=2). The node distribution function 
                              and element size remains constant near a
                              boundary node for a distance equal to   
                              the node distribution function at the   
                              boundary multiplied by cdfs.            
 
2         0         10        cdfssrc                 
                              Source distribution function excl. zone.
                              The source distribution function and    
                              transformation vector magnitude (mtr>=1)
                              remain constant near a source node for a
                              distance equal to the source            
                              distribution function multiplied by     
                              cdfssrc. Only applicable if the source  
                              option flag and source node grid options
                              are on (msource=2) or the transformation
                              growth option flag is on (mtr=2).       
 
0.25      0         0.7       cdse                    
                              Small edge factor.                      
                              Small edges are eleted if the small edge
                              deletion flag is on (mdse=1). Small     
                              edges are defined as those with a ratio 
                              of actual edge length to local length   
                              scale of cdse or less. Only applicable  
                              if the small edge deletion flag is on   
                              (mdse=1).                               
 
0.1       0         0.5       cinlpp                  
                              Initial centroid point placement factor.
                              During grid generation large elements   
                              that have all edges larger than the     
                              distribution function (local point      
                              spacing) are subdivided using centroid  
                              point placement. Elements that have a   
                              ratio of local spacing over minimum edge
                              length less than cinlpp are subdivided. 
                              Only applicable if initial centroid     
                              point placement is on (minlpp=1).       
 
0.8       0         1         csrcw                   
                              Source weight.                          
                              Weighting factor used to determine      
                              distribution function and transformation
                              vectors (mtr>=1) from sources. The      
                              distribution function and transformation
                              vectors (if mtr>=1) from sources are    
                              weighted by csrcw and that from the     
                              local grid is weighted by 1-csrcw. Only 
                              applicable if the source option flag    
                              and source node grid options are on     
                              (msource==2).                           
 
-1        -1        1e+19     dfmax                   
                              Maximum distribution function.          
                              The distribution function specifies the 
                              point spacing in the field.             
                              If dfmax < 0 then do not limit the      
                              maximum distribution function.          
                              If dfmax = 0 then limit the maximum     
                              distribution function to the maximum    
                              value determined from the boundary      
                              surface grid.                           
                              If dfmax > 0 then limit the maximum     
                              distribution function to dfmax.         
 
0         0         1e+19     trds                    
                              Surf transformation normal spacing.     
                              If trds > 0 then set the initial normal 
                              spacing for anisotropic transformation  
                              to trds on all source type transparent  
                              boundary surfaces.                      
                              If trds = 0 then use the initial normal 
                              spacing specified in the input surface  
                              grid to determine the initial normal    
                              spacing for anisotropic transformation  
                              on all source type transparent boundary 
                              surfaces.                               
                              Only applicable if the spacing          
                              transformation flag is on (mtr>=1) and  
                              there are source type transparent       
                              boundary surface faces.                 
 
100       1         1e+19     trmmax                  
                              Maximum aniostropic blending vector.    
                              Anisotropic transformation vectors can  
                              be used to blend from high-aspect-ratio 
                              boundary surface elements to isotropic  
                              elements. The maximum magnitude of the  
                              normal and tangential direction         
                              transformation vector is limited to be  
                              less than trmmax. Only applicable if    
                              anisotropic to isotropic aspect-ratio   
                              blending is on (mtrsrcb=1).             
 
0.1       0         1         lsrpplim                
                              LSR point placement limit factor.       
                              Initial length scale reduction point    
                              placement is used for initial elements  
                              that have length scales smaller than    
                              lsrpplim. Normal point placement is used
                              after the initial element length scales 
                              are reduced or after nlsrpp passes.     
                              Only applicable if partition mode option
                              is on (mpartm=1) and more than one      
                              partition is requested (npart>1).       
 
170       90        179.9     angblqfmax              
                              Maximum BL interface face angle.        
                              BL elements are rejected if the local BL
                              interface surface has a maximum face    
                              angle that is greater than angblqfmax.  
                              The maximum allowable angle is increased
                              from angblqfmax to angblqfmax2 if the   
                              corresponding surface face angle is     
                              greater that angblqfmax. BL grid        
                              advancement is terminated locally when  
                              an element is rejected. The value of    
                              angblqfmax is internally limited to be  
                              less than angblqfmax2. Only applicable  
                              if the B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).   
 
179       90        179.9     angblqfmax2             
                              Maximum BL interface face angle #2.     
                              BL elements are rejected if the local BL
                              interface face has a maximum face       
                              angle that is greater than angblqfmax.  
                              The maximum allowable angle is increased
                              from angblqfmax to angblqfmax2 if the   
                              corresponding surface face angle is     
                              greater that angblqfmax. BL grid        
                              advancement is terminated locally when  
                              an element is rejected. The value of    
                              angblqfmax2 is internally limited to be 
                              less than angqbf. Only applicable if the
                              B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).          
 
165       90        179.9     angblqmax               
                              Maximum BL dihedral element angle.      
                              BL elements are rejected if their       
                              maximum angle is greater than angblqmax.
                              The maximum allowable angle is increased
                              from angblqmax to angblqmaxd dependent  
                              upon the level of disconinuity (as      
                              defined by angbldd and angbldd2). BL    
                              grid advancement is terminated locally  
                              when an element is rejected. The value  
                              of angblqmax is internally limited to be
                              less than angblqmaxd.                   
                              Only applicable if the SNS BL flag is   
                              on (mbl=-1).                            
                              Only applicable if the CFD BL flag is   
                              on (mbl=1).                             
 
175       90        180       angblqmaxd              
                              Maximum discontinuous BL dihedral angle.
                              BL elements are rejected if their       
                              maximum dihedral angle is large. The    
                              maximum allowable angle is increased    
                              from angblqmax to angblqmaxd dependent  
                              upon the level of disconinuity (as      
                              defined by angbldd and angbldd2). BL    
                              grid advancement is terminated locally  
                              when an element is rejected.            
                              Only applicable if the SNS BL flag is   
                              on (mbl=-1).                            
                              Only applicable if the CFD BL flag is on
                              on (mbl=1).                             
 
179       90        180       angblqmaxd2             
                              Maximum convex disc. BL dihedral angle. 
                              BL elements are rejected if their       
                              maximum dihedral angle is large. The    
                              maximum allowable angle is increased    
                              from angblqmax to angblqmaxd2 at convex 
                              points dependent upon the level of      
                              disconinuity (as defined by angbldd and 
                              angbldd2). BL grid advancement is       
                              terminated locally when an element is   
                              rejected.                               
                              Only applicable if the SNS BL flag is   
                              on (mbl=-1).                            
                              Only applicable if the CFD BL flag is   
                              on (mbl=1).                             
 
165       90        179.9     angslqmax               
                              Maximum SL dihedral element angle.      
                              SL elements are rejected if their       
                              maximum angle is greater than angblqmax.
                              The maximum allowable angle is increased
                              from angblqmax to angblqmaxd dependent  
                              upon the level of disconinuity (as      
                              defined by angbldd and angbldd2). SL    
                              grid advancement is terminated locally  
                              when an element is rejected. The value  
                              of angblqmax is internally limited to be
                              less than angblqmaxd. Only applicable if
                              if the SL flag is on (mbl=2).           
 
175       90        180       angslqmaxd              
                              Maximum discontinuous SL dihedral angle.
                              SL elements are rejected if their       
                              maximum dihedral angle is large. The    
                              maximum allowable angle is increased    
                              from angblqmax to angblqmaxd dependent  
                              upon the level of disconinuity (as      
                              defined by angbldd and angbldd2). SL    
                              grid advancement is terminated locally  
                              when an element is rejected. Only       
                              applicable if the SL flag is on (mbl=2).
 
0         0         1000      bldup                   
                              Normalized BL velocity increment.       
                              Specifies the normalized BL velocity    
                              increment to use in determining the BL  
                              geometric growth rate parameters.       
                              If mbltype = 1 then the normalized BL   
                              velocity increment is the velocity      
                              increment normalized with the velocity  
                              at the edge of the BL.                  
                              If mbltype = 2 then the normalized BL   
                              velocity increment is the u+ increment  
                              (velocity increment normalized with the 
                              friction velocity).                     
                              If the BL velocity increment is not set 
                              and the normalized BL normal spacing,   
                              blyp, is set to then the value of bldup 
                              is calculated internally. Only          
                              applicable if the CFD BL flag is on     
                              (mbl=1) and the BL auto-parameter flag  
                              is on (mblauto=1).                      
 
1e+06     0.0001    1e+19     blre                    
                              Reference Reynolds number.              
                              Specifies reference Reynolds number per 
                              unit grid dimension for determining the 
                              parameters that control spacing normal  
                              to BL surfaces. If the flow direction   
                              vector is specified (|vx,vy,vz| > 0)    
                              then the local Reynolds number is       
                              dependent upon the distance from the    
                              leading edge in the flow direction.     
                              Otherwise the Reynolds number everywhere
                              is based on the reference value (see    
                              refx). Only applicable if the CFD BL    
                              flag is on (mbl=1) and the BL type flag 
                              is on (mbltype>=1).                     
 
0         0         1000      blyp                    
                              Normalized BL normal spacing.           
                              Specifies the normalized BL spacing to  
                              use in determining the BL initial normal
                              spacing.                                
                              If mbltype = 1 then the normalized BL   
                              normal spacing is the fraction of the   
                              laminar BL thickness for the initial    
                              normal spacing.                         
                              If mbltype = 2 then the normalized BL   
                              normal spacing is the y+ value for the  
                              initial normal spacing.                 
                              If the BL auto-parameter flag is on     
                              (mblauto=1) and both blyp and dsdef are 
                              both set to zero and the normalized BL  
                              velocity increment, bldup, is not set to
                              zero then the value of blyp is          
                              calculated internally from bldup. Also, 
                              if the BL auto-parameter flag is on then
                              the BL normal spacing throughout the    
                              linear region is equal to the BL initial
                              normal spacing set by blyp. The linear  
                              If mbltype = 1 then the linear region is
                              about 1/3 of the laminar BL thickness.  
                              If mbltype = 2 then the linear region is
                              the turbulent linear region y+<=5.      
                              Only applicable if the CFD BL flag is on
                              (mbl=1) and the BL type flag is on      
                              (mbltype>=1).                           
 
0.9       0         100       cblcncvmnr              
                              Concave max. normal-dir-aspect-ratio.   
                              BL advancement is locally terminated in 
                              concave regions if the normal aspect    
                              ratio is larger than cblcncvmnr. A      
                              region is considered concave if the     
                              local ratio of edge lengths within the  
                              BL to the corresponding edges on the    
                              initial surface is less than cblcncv.   
                              If the SNS BL flag is on (mbl=-1) then  
                              (mbl=-1) then this applies only in the  
                              transition zone. Only applicable if the 
                              BL/SL flag is on (mbl!=0).              
 
0.5       0         1000      cbldel                  
                              BL thickness slope multiplier.          
                              The specified BL thickness (if          
                              specified) is multiplied by a factor    
                              dependent upon the angle between the    
                              local surface normal and the flow       
                              direction vector [vx,vy,vz]. The factor 
                              varies from 1, if the angle is between  
                              90 and 270 degrees, up to 1+cbldel, if  
                              the angle is between 0 and 90 or 270 and
                              360 degrees. Only applicable if the CFD 
                              BL flag is on (mbl=1).                  
 
0.5       0         1         cbldsm                  
                              BL sub-layer spacing multiplier.        
                              BL normal spacing is increased multiple 
                              layers during generation and then       
                              subdivided after the entire BL grid is  
                              generated to obtain the true spacing.   
                              The maximum normal spacing is limited to
                              be less than cbldsm multiplied by the   
                              minimum surface point spacing. If       
                              cbldsm=0 then the all layers are        
                              generated at the true spacing.          
                              Only applicable if the SNS BL flag is   
                              on (mbl=-1).                            
                              Only applicable if the CFD BL flag is   
                              on (mbl=1).                             
 
0.1       0         1         cblend                  
                              Global BL termination factor.           
                              BL advancement is globally terminated   
                              if the number of active nodes that are  
                              less than a BL thickness (if defined)   
                              away from the surface and that have a   
                              normal-direction-aspect-ratio less than 
                              cblnrend and greater than cblnrendm is  
                              below cblend times the total number of  
                              BL nodes. Only applicable if the        
                              B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).          
 
0.7       0         100       cblmnr                  
                              Maximum normal-direction-aspect-ratio.  
                              BL normal spacing is limited so that the
                              normal-direction-aspect-ratio is less   
                              than cblmnr. If the SNS BL flag is on   
                              (mbl=-1) then this applies only in the  
                              transition zone. Only applicable if the 
                              B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).          
 
0.7       0         100       cblnrchkbf              
                              Checking normal-direction-aspect-ratio. 
                              BL/SL/SNS grid generation is terminated 
                              locally if the edge length between      
                              active BL nodes grows to a value that is
                              greater than cdffblm2 multiplied by the 
                              corresponding edge length on the initial
                              boundary surface. A modified factor is  
                              used (between cdffblm2 and 2*cdffblm2)  
                              if the aspect-ratio between the normal  
                              spacing and edge length is less than    
                              cblnrchkbf. Note that cblnrchkbf should 
                              always be less than or equal to cblmnr. 
                              If not it will be reset to the value of 
                              cblmnr. Only applicable if the BL/SL/SNS
                              flag is on (mbl!=0) and cdffblm2>1.     
 
0.5       0         100       cblnrendm               
                              Minimum normal-direction-aspect-ratio.  
                              BL advancement is globally terminated   
                              if the number of active nodes that are  
                              less than a BL thickness (if defined)   
                              away from the surface and that have a   
                              normal-direction-aspect-ratio less than 
                              cblmnr and greater than cblnrendm is    
                              below cblend times the total number of  
                              always be less than or equal to cblmnr. 
                              If not it will reset to the value of    
                              of cblmnr. Only applicable if the       
                              B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).          
 
1         0.1       1000      cblsmax                 
                              BL thickness multiplier.                
                              The specified BL thickness (if          
                              specified) is multiplied by cblsmax to  
                              determine the thickness of the BL grid  
                              region. Only applicable if the CFD BL   
                              flag is on (mbl=1).                     
 
0.5       0         1000      cblsmaxs                
                              BL normal smoothing multiplier.         
                              The BL normal vectors are smoothed      
                              iteratively using a smoothing           
                              coefficient that varies from 0 at the   
                              surface to 1 at a distance from the     
                              surface equal to the local surface      
                              spacing multiplied by cblsmaxs. Only    
                              applicable if the CFD BL flag is on     
                              (mbl=1).                                
 
1         0         1000      cblsmaxsd               
                              BL normal smoothing discon. multiplier. 
                              The BL normal vectors are smoothed at   
                              convex discontinuous nodes using a      
                              factor that varies from 0 at the surface
                              to 1 at a normal distance away equal to 
                              the local surface spacing multiplied by 
                              cblsmaxsd. Only applicable if the CFD BL
                              flag is on (mbl=1).                     
 
0.5       0         1         cblsmthd                
                              Smoothing BL thickness multiplier.      
                              The effective BL normal vector smoothing
                              coefficient is reduced by a factor equal
                              to cblsmthd at convex discontinuous     
                              points. Only applicable if the CFD BL   
                              is on (mbl=1).                          
 
0.25      1e-06     1         cblxlim                 
                              Minimum distance for BL variation.      
                              Relative distance below which the       
                              streamwise variation in the             
                              BL profile is ignored. Only applicable  
                              if the CFD BL flag is on (mbl=1) and the
                              flow direction vector is specified      
                              (|vx,vy,vz| > 0).                       
 
1.2       0.25      1e+06     cdf2                    
                              Distribution function multiplier #2.    
                              The distribution function multiplier #2,
                              cdf2, is used exactly as the standard   
                              distribution function multiplier, cdf,  
                              on all boundary surface faces with a    
                              negative grid boundary condition. Only  
                              appl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is on  
                              (mbl!=0).                               
 
1.5       1         10        cdffblm1                
                              Maximum BL edge length factor #1.       
                              BL/SL/SNS grid generation is terminated 
                              locally if the edge length between an   
                              active and inactive BL node is greater  
                              than cdffblm1 multiplied by the maximum 
                              of the local normal spacing and the     
                              edge length between the same nodes at   
                              the last level that they were active.   
                              Only appl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is
                              on (mbl!=0).                            
 
1         1         1e+06     cdffblm2                
                              Maximum BL edge length factor #2.       
                              BL/SL/SNS grid generation is terminated 
                              locally if the edge length between      
                              active BL nodes grows to a value that is
                              greater than cdffblm2 multiplied by the 
                              corresponding edge length on the initial
                              boundary surface. A larger factor than  
                              cdffblm2 is used aspect-ratio between   
                              the normal spacing and edge length is   
                              less than cblnrchkbf. If cdffblm2=1.0   
                              then the checking of active edge        
                              lengths is turned off. Only applicable  
                              if the B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).   
 
0.25      0         10        cdfnbl                  
                              Nearby BL node factor.                  
                              Adjacent BL nodes of the same face are  
                              considered too close if the distance    
                              between them is less than the local     
                              length scale multiplied by cdfnbl. Only 
                              appl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is on  
                              (mbl!=0).                               
 
1         1         3         cdfrbl                  
                              BL geometric growth rate.               
                              Used as the geometric growth rate for   
                              node distribution normal to the boundary
                              surface within the BL grid. If the BL   
                              auto-parameter flag is on (mblauto=1)   
                              then the value of cdfrbl is calculated  
                              internally. Only applicable if the      
                              CFD BL flag is on (mbl=1)               
 
1.5       1.001     4         cdfrblm                 
                              Maximum BL geometric growth rate.       
                              Maximum geometric growth rate for node  
                              distribution normal to the boundary     
                              surface within the BL grid. The         
                              geometric growth rate increases at a    
                              rate specified by dcdfrbl. If the BL    
                              auto-parameter flag is on (mblauto=1)   
                              then the value of cdfrblm may be re-set 
                              if the internally calculated value is   
                              less than input value of cdfrblm. Only  
                              applicable if the CFD BL flag is on     
                              (mbl=1).                                
 
1.2       1         3         cdfrsl                  
                              SL geometric growth rate.               
                              SL geometric growth rate for node       
                              distribution normal to the boundary     
                              surface. The geometric growth rate is   
                              constant within the SL region. Only     
                              applicable if the SL flag is on (mbl=2).
 
1.2       1         3         cdfrsns                 
                              SNS geometric growth rate.              
                              SNS geometric growth rate for node      
                              distribution normal to the boundary     
                              surface. The geometric growth rate is   
                              set to cdfrsns in the transition zone   
                              between the region where normal spacing 
                              is specified and the isotropic region.  
                              If cdfrsns=1 then there will be no      
                              transition zone and outside the region  
                              where normal spacing is specified the   
                              elements will immediately transition to 
                              isotropic tets. Only applicable if the  
                              SNS flag is on (mbl=-1).                
 
0.5       1e-13     3         cdfslm                  
                              SL initial normal spacing multiplier.   
                              The initial normal spacing is set equal 
                              to the local length scale multiplied by 
                              cdfslm. Only applicable if the SL flag  
                              is on (mbl=2).                          
 
0.5       0         1         cslend                  
                              Global SL termination factor.           
                              SL advancement is globally terminated   
                              if the number of active nodes are less  
                              than cslend times the total number of SL
                              nodes. Only pplicable if the SL flag is 
                              on (mbl=2).                             
 
1.05      1         2         dcdfrbl                 
                              BL geometric growth acceleration rate.  
                              The BL growth rate (cdfrbl) increases at
                              a rate equal to dcdfrbl. If the BL auto-
                              parameter flag is on (mblauto=1) then   
                              the value of dcdfrbl is calculated      
                              internally. Only applicable if the      
                              CFD BL flag is on (mbl=1) and the BL    
                              auto-parameter flag is off (mblauto=0). 
 
-1        -1        1e+19     deldef                  
                              BL thickness.                           
                              The BL region will have a thickness     
                              equal to deldef. This parameter will    
                              override the BL thickness array if it is
                              set to a non-zero value. If the value of
                              deldef is zero then a value for deldef  
                              will be calculated internally. If the   
                              value of deldef is negative then        
                              thickness will be set to zero and not   
                              used. Only applicable if the CFD BL flag
                              is on (mbl=1).                          
 
0         0         1e+19     dsdef                   
                              BL initial normal spacing.              
                              The first layer of BL elements have a   
                              normal spacing equal to dsdef. This     
                              parameter will override the initial     
                              normal spacing array if it is set to a  
                              non-zero value. If the BL auto-parameter
                              flag is on (mblauto=1) and the value of 
                              dsdef is zero then a value will be      
                              calculated internally. Only applicable  
                              if the CFD BL flag is on (mbl=1) and the
                              BL auto-parameter flag is off           
                              (mblauto=0).                            
 
1         0         1e+06     dsmul                   
                              BL spacing multiplier.                  
                              The initial normal spacing, calculated  
                              or input, is multiplied by dsmul. Only  
                              applicable if the CFD BL flag is on     
                              (mbl=1).                                
 
0         0         1e+19     refx                    
                              Reference length.                       
                              Specifies reference length in grid      
                              units. The reference length is used to  
                              calculate BL parameters.                
                              If refx = 0 then the reference length is
                              set to the maximum physical length of   
                              all BL objects (and if the flow         
                              direction vector is specified           
                              (|vx,vy,vz| > 0) then the maximum length
                              in the flow direction is used.          
                              If refx > 0 then the value of refx is   
                              used. Only applicable if the CFD BL flag
                              is on (mbl=1) and the BL type flag is on
                              (mbltype>=1).                           
 
0         -1e+19    1e+19     vx                      
                              Flow X-direction vector component.      
                              If the magnitude of the flow direction  
                              vector |vx,vy,vz| is greater than zero  
                              and the BL auto-parameter flag is on    
                              (mblauto=1) then the streamwise         
                              variation in the BL profile is accounted
                              for. Only applicable if the CFD BL flag 
                              is on (mbl=1) and the BL auto-parameter 
                              flag is on (mblauto=1).                 
 
0         -1e+19    1e+19     vy                      
                              Flow Y-direction vector component.      
                              If the magnitude of the flow direction  
                              vector |vx,vy,vz| is greater than zero  
                              and the BL auto-parameter flag is on    
                              (mblauto=1) then the streamwise         
                              variation in the BL profile is accounted
                              for. Only applicable if the CFD BL flag 
                              is on (mbl=1) and the BL auto-parameter 
                              flag is on (mblauto=1).                 
 
0         -1e+19    1e+19     vz                      
                              Flow Z-direction vector component.      
                              If the magnitude of the flow direction  
                              vector |vx,vy,vz| is greater than zero  
                              and the BL auto-parameter flag is on    
                              (mblauto=1) then the streamwise         
                              variation in the BL profile is accounted
                              for. Only applicable if the CFD BL flag 
                              is on (mbl=1) and the BL auto-parameter 
                              flag is on (mblauto=1).                 
 
*         *         *         PS_TMs                  
                              Periodic surface rotation matrix list.  
                              For each periodic surface pair the      
                              rotation matrix between the coordinate  
                              systems of the parent and child surfaces
                              is specified in the list of rotation    
                              matricies, PS_TMs. The list PS_TMs      
                              contains the total number translation   
                              matricie components (9 for each periodic
                              surface pair) followed by the list of   
                              components. For example, if the list    
                              PS_TMs is set to 9,1,0,0,0,1,0,0,0,1    
                              then there are 9 entries (must be a     
                              multiple of 9) in the vector and one    
                              periodic surface pair. The translation  
                              matrix for the pair is 1,0,0,0,1,0,0,0,1
                              (this example is for a case with no     
                              rotation). Each row or the translation  
                              matrix is actually the direction cosines
                              for each coodinate axis (row 1 is for   
                              the x-axis, row 2 is for the y-axis, and
                              row 3 is for the z-axis). Only          
                              appl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is on  
                              (mbl!=0).                               
 
*         *         *         PS_XPS0s                
                              Periodic surf. translation vector list. 
                              For each periodic surface pair the      
                              translation vector between the          
                              coordinate systems of the parent and    
                              child surfaces is specified in the list 
                              of translation vectors, PS_XPS0s. The   
                              list PS_XPS0s contains the total number 
                              of translation vector x,y,z components  
                              (3 for each periodic surface pair)      
                              followed by the list of components. For 
                              example, if the list PS_XPS0s is set to 
                              6,1.1,0.2,3.7,4.4,1.2,0.2 then there are
                              6 entries (must be a multiple of 3) in  
                              the vector and two periodic surface     
                              pairs. The x,y,z translation vector for 
                              the first pair is 1.1,0.2,3.7 and for   
                              the second pair it is 4.4,1.2,0.2. Only 
                              appl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is on  
                              (mbl!=0).                               
 
*         *         *         SNS                     
                              Specified normal spacing distribution.  
                              If the vector SNS is set along with the 
                              list of specified spacing groups SNS_IDs
                              then the normal spacing for each group  
                              is set (and it must be if the SNS flag  
                              is on mbl=-1). Each normal spacing group
                              within the vector SNS must be sequential
                              and start at a value of 0. The number of
                              normal spacing groups (number of zero   
                              entries in vector SNS) must be the same 
                              for both vectors SNS and SNS_IDs. The   
                              vector SNS is composed of the normal    
                              spacing distribution for all groups.    
                              For example, if the vector SNS is set to
                              10,0,.1,.2,.3,.4,0,.05,.1,.2,.5 then    
                              there are 10 entries in the vector and  
                              two groups. The normal distribution for 
                              group 1 is set to 0,.1,.2,.3,.4 and for 
                              group 2 it is set to 0,.05,.1,.2,.5.    
                              Only applicable if the SNS flag is on   
                              (mbl=-1).                               
 
test                          Input_Grid_File_Name    
                              Case name or input grid file name.      
                              Specifies either the case name or full  
                              file name for the input grid file. See  
                              the UG_IO description on file naming for
                              more information.                       
                              This is an AFLR3_SYSTEM LIB parameter.  
.b8.ugrid                     Output_Grid_File_Name   
                              Output grid file name or suffix.        
                              Specifies either the full file name or  
                              file name suffix for the output grid    
                              file. See the UG_IO description on file 
                              naming for more information.            
                              This is an AFLR3_SYSTEM LIB parameter.  
                              TMP_File_Dir            
                              Temporary file directory.               
                              If TMP_File_Dir is set then all         
                              temporary files are created in directory
                              TMP_File_Dir. This directory is removed 
                              at completion of the job. If code       
                              execution is abruptly terminated then   
                              this directory and its contents may be  
                              left behind and not removed.            
 
 
 
**********************************************************************
            THE FOLLOWING PARAMETERS SHOULD NOT BE CHANGED!
**********************************************************************
 
Default   Minimum   Maximum   Parameter
Value     Value     Value     Name and Description
-------   -------   -------   --------------------
1         -6        4         Grid_Generation_Flag    
                              Program flag.                           
                              Not used except for compatibility.      
                              Value is ignored and is exactly the same
                              as Program_Flag.                        
 
1         1         10        Number_of_Calls         
                              Number of program calls.                
                              If Number_of_Calls = 1 then run AFLR3   
                              once as normal.                         
                              If Number_of_Calls > 1 then run AFLR3   
                              Number_of_Calls times for the same case.
                              This is an AFLR3_SYSTEM LIB parameter.  
 
1         -6        2         Program_Flag            
                              Program flag.                           
                              If Program_Flag = 2 then perform normal 
                              grid generation using grid generation   
                              routine with simplified interface.      
                              If Program_Flag = 1 then perform normal 
                              grid generation.                        
                              If Program_Flag = 0 then skip           
                              grid generation. In this case an input  
                              grid file is read in. That grid is      
                              written out using the specified output  
                              grid file format and type.              
                              If Program_Flag = -1 then skip all grid 
                              generation, do not read in an input grid
                              file, and generate an output description
                              of the UG_IO file names.                
                              If Program_Flag = -2 then skip all grid 
                              generation, do not read in an input grid
                              file, and generate an output description
                              summary of the UG_IO file names.        
                              If Program_Flag = -3 then skip all grid 
                              generation, do not read in an input grid
                              file, and generate an output description
                              of the AFLR3 grid generation parameters.
                              If Program_Flag = -4 then skip all grid 
                              generation, do not read in an input grid
                              file, and generate an output description
                              summary of the AFLR3 grid generation    
                              parameters.                             
                              If Program_Flag = -5 then read input    
                              parameter file and check all AFLR3 grid 
                              generation parameters.                  
                              If Program_Flag = -6 then read in an    
                              input grid file, skip all grid          
                              generation, and generate grid quality   
                              data.                                   
                              This is an AFLR3_SYSTEM LIB parameter.  
 
1         0         1         mchkvoli                
                              Input grid volume check flag.           
                              If mchkvoli = 0 then do not check       
                              element volumes of the input grid.      
                              If mchkvoli = 1 then check element      
                              volumes of the input grid.              
                              This option is only applicable if       
                              the input grid is a volume grid and not 
                              just a surface grid.                    
 
1         0         1         mdbs                    
                              Boundary sliver deletion flag.          
                              If mdbs = 1 then delete boundary sliver 
                              elements. The boundary surface triangles
                              are reconnected to delete boundary      
                              slivers.                                
                              If mdbs = 0 then do not delete boundary 
                              sliver elements.                        
 
1         0         1         mdse                    
                              Small edge deletion flag.               
                              If mdse = 1 then delete small edges.    
                              If mdbs = 0 then do not delete small    
                              edges.                                  
 
0         0         1         mfchkn                  
                              Candidate to node checking flag.        
                              If mfchkn = 1 then check distance       
                              between candidate nodes and all existing
                              nodes.                                  
                              If mfchkn = 0 then check distance       
                              between candidate nodes and nearby      
                              existing nodes.                         
 
1         0         1         mimadd                  
                              Inl. grid gen. element flag option.     
                              If mimadd = 1 then set the elements     
                              attached to unrecovered boundary faces  
                              to be active during boundary recovery   
                              local reconnection.                     
                              If mimadd = 0 then set all elements to  
                              be active during boundary recovery local
                              reconnection.                           
 
0         0         1         mrec4                   
                              4-4 element local-Reconnection flag.    
                              If mrec4 = 1 then reconnect 4-4 element 
                              combinations during grid generation.    
                              If mrec4 = 0 then reconnect 4-4 element 
                              only during final quality improvement.  
                              If the initial surface triangulation is 
                              of low quality (see angqbfm) then the   
                              value of mrec4 is ignored and mrec4 is  
                              automatically set to a value of 1.      
 
2         1         3         mrecim                  
                              Initial local-reconnection flag.        
                              If mrecim = 1 then use a Delaunay       
                              criterion.                              
                              If mrecim = 2 then use a combined       
                              Delaunay and MIN-MAX-Angle criterion.   
                              If mrecim = 3 then use a combined       
                              Delaunay and MAX-MIN-Rratio criterion.  
 
1         1         2         msmth                   
                              Smoothing flag.                         
                              If msmth = 1 then optimal placement     
                              smoothing is used initially.            
                              If msmth = 2 then centroid averaging is 
                              used for smoothing.                     
 
1         0         1         mtrb                    
                              B-face aspect-ratio transformation flag.
                              If mtrb = 1 then use a local            
                              transformation to account for boundary  
                              face aspect-ratio.                      
                              If mtrb = 0 then do not use a local     
                              transformation.                         
                              Boundary faces with high aspect-ratio   
                              typically require transformation.       
 
100       2         2000000000nbfmqrgen               
                              Maximum quality imprv/re-gen b-faces.   
                              Maximum number of true boundary surface 
                              allowed in a single low-quality region  
                              during quality improvement grid         
                              re-generation. A large number of faces  
                              indicates that there are issues with the
                              boundary surface grid that can not be   
                              addressed with grid re-generation. Only 
                              applicable if the quality improvement   
                              re-gen. flag is on (mqrgen=1).          
 
10        1         10000000  nbngrp                  
                              Number of boundary node groups.         
                              Number of groups to sort boundary nodes 
                              into for boundary node insertion.       
 
1000      100       10000000  nelemdm                 
                              Minimum number of elements to allocate. 
                              Minimum value for number of elements to 
                              allocate space for.                     
 
5         4         100       nelhull                 
                              Number of convex hull element pairs.    
                              Number of initial enclosing convex hull 
                              element pairs for boundary node         
                              insertion. The convex hull is formed    
                              from two reflected sets of elements     
                              rotated about the z-axis.               
 
5         3         7         nelpnn                  
                              Number of elements per node.            
                              The maximum number of nodes allocated   
                              is set to the maximum of either the     
                              number of elements allocated divided by 
                              nelpnn or the number of initial nodes   
                              multiplied by nnpnni.                   
 
5         1         100       nelpnni                 
                              Number of initial elements per node.    
                              The maximum number of initial elements  
                              allocated is set to the number of nodes 
                              in the boundary surface grid multiplied 
                              by nelpnni. This is used only if there  
                              is not an initial volume triangulation  
                              and it is used only for the initial     
                              volume triangulation.                   
 
100000    0         100000000 ngen                    
                              Maximum number of grid passes.          
 
3         1         10000000  ninsmax                 
                              Maximum inl grid element subdivisions.  
                              Maximum number of element subdivisions  
                              for direct boundary node insertion      
                              during initial grid generation.         
 
100       1         10000000  ninsmaxgg               
                              Maximum field grid elem. subdivisions.  
                              Maximum number of element subdivisions  
                              for direct node insertion during field  
                              grid generation.                        
 
10        1         10000000  nlsrgen                 
                              Maximum number of LSRatio passes.       
                              Source nodes are generated to improve   
                              (LSRatio). Only applicable if surface   
                              or iterative mode LSRatio improvement   
                              flag is on (mlsr=1 or 2).               
 
10000     100       10000000  nmnrealloc              
                              Minimum array elements to reallocate.   
                              Minimum number of new array elements to 
                              add if the initial estimate for maximum 
                              number of elements is too low.          
 
100       10        10000     nnpbchk                 
                              Oct-tree bin checking node limit.       
                              Limit used during generation of oct-tree
                              for checking source nodes. The node     
                              limit target for final bins is set to   
                              nnpbchk boundary nodes.                 
 
10        10        10000     nnpbeval                
                              Oct-tree bin evaluation node limit.     
                              Limit used during generation of oct-tree
                              bins for evaluating distribution        
                              function and transformation vectors from
                              source nodes. The node limit target for 
                              final bins is set to nnpbeval source    
                              nodes. Only applicable if the source    
                              option flag and source node grid options
                              are on (msource=2).                     
 
2         1         10        nnpnni                  
                              Number of nodes per initial node.       
                              The maximum number of nodes allocated   
                              is set to the maximum of either the     
                              number of elements allocated divided by 
                              by nelpnn or the number of initial nodes
                              multiplied by nnpnni.                   
 
10        0         1000000   nqrgadd                 
                              Min. additional grid re-gen. nodes.     
                              During quality improvement grid re-     
                              generation the distribution fundtion    
                              multiplier cdfqrg is iteratively        
                              reduced. If quality improves then       
                              iteration ends. Quality is checked until
                              at least nqrgadd new nodes are          
                              generated. Only applicable if the       
                              quality improvement re-gen. flag is on  
                              (mqrgen=1).                             
 
4         1         10        nqrgen                  
                              Quality improvement re-gen. iterations. 
                              Initially the size of the re-generation 
                              region is restricted to the elements    
                              attached to low quality elements. On    
                              each subsequent quality improvement     
                              re-generation iteration the size of the 
                              region is increased. Re-generation is   
                              terminated if the maximum dihderal      
                              element angle is reduced below angqrgen.
                              It is also terminated if there is no    
                              improvement in quality and there are no 
                              elements with a maximum dihderal angle  
                              greater than angqrmax. Only applicable  
                              if the quality improvement re-gen. flag 
                              is on (mqrgen=1).                       
 
2         1         10        nqr                     
                              Maximum quality imprv/re-gen passes.    
                              Maximum number of times to repeat       
                              quality improvement and re-generation if
                              grid quality is very low (maximum       
                              dihedral angle greater than angqrmax).  
 
2         0         10        nqual                   
                              Number of quality improvement passes.   
                              If nqual = 0 then all quality           
                              improvement is skipped.                 
 
1         0         10        nqualf                  
                              Number of quality improvement repeats.  
                              Maximum number of times to repeat       
                              quality improvement if grid quality is  
                              too low.                                
 
3         0         10        nsmth                   
                              Number of smoothing iterations.         
 
2         0         2         mpdone                  
                              Partition mode completion flag.         
                              Elements are considered satisfied if    
                              they satisfy both the maximum angle and 
                              satisfied edge length conditions using  
                              limits set by angpmax1 and cdffp1.      
                              If mpdone = 0 then consider elements    
                              completed only if they are considered   
                              satisfied.                              
                              If mpdone = 1 then consider elements    
                              completed if they are considered        
                              satisfied or if all elements in a       
                              complete sub-volume satisfy the         
                              conditions using the limits set by      
                              angpmax2 and cdffp2.                    
                              If mpdone = 2 then consider elements    
                              completed as with mpdone=1 except for   
                              those elements that are satisfied and   
                              also connected to another element that  
                              is not satisfied.                       
                              Only applicable if partition mode option
                              is on (mpartm=1) and more than one      
                              partition is requested (npart>1).       
 
1000      1         1000000000nfchkrep                
                              Max number of repeat file status checks.
                              File status checks are repeated up to   
                              nfchkrep times to account for latency in
                              the file system.                        
 
10000000  0         100000000 npgen                   
                              Maximum number of partitioning passes.  
                              Only applicable if partition mode option
                              is on (mpartm=1) and more than one      
                              partition is requested (npart>1).       
 
10000     0         10000000  nbld                    
                              Maximum total BL grid layers allowable. 
                              Only appl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is
                              on (mbl!=0).                            
 
5         2         100       nbldd                   
                              Number of disconinuity levels.          
                              The maximum allowable BL element        
                              dihedral angle is varied dependent upon 
                              the level of discontinuity in nbldd     
                              levels. Only applicable if the BL/SL/SNS
                              flag is on (mbl!=0).                    
 
3         2         100       nblpnmin                
                              Minimum number of surrounding BL nodes. 
                              If there are less than nblpnmin active  
                              nodes surrounding an active node then   
                              that node is terminated. Only applicable
                              if the B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).   
 
20        -1        10000000  nblrbf                  
                              BL level difference reconnection limit. 
                              BL surface face reconnection is limited 
                              if the maximum difference between the   
                              number of BL levels for the BL nodes on 
                              the face is greater than nblrbf.        
                              If nblrbf = -1 then BL surface face     
                              reconnection is not limited by BL level.
                              Only appl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is
                              on (mbl!=0).                            
 
100       0         10000000  ndfsmth                 
                              Max distribution func BL smoothing itrs.
                              The distribution function values used to
                              limit the BL are smoothed up to ndfsmth 
                              iterations. Only applicable if the      
                              B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).          
 
100       *         *         GQ_Max_Dist_Increments  
                              Maximum quality distribution increments.
                              Maximum number of grid quality          
                              distribution increments.                
                              This is a UG_GQ LIB parameter.          
 
140       90        179.9     angbd                   
                              ID group discontinuous surface angle.   
                              Dihedral angle between two adjacent     
                              faces used to set boundary surface ID   
                              for groups of faces that are adjacent   
                              and have a dihedral angle between any   
                              two faces of the group that is less than
                              angbd. Only applicable if the grid      
                              boundary condition option is on         
                              (msetbc=1).                             
 
160       120       179.9     angdbs                  
                              Boundary sliver dihedral element angle. 
                              All boundary elements with a dihedral   
                              angle greater than angdbs are considered
                              slivers and are deleted. The boundary   
                              surface triangles are reconnected to    
                              delete boundary slivers.                
 
175       120       179.9     angdfs                  
                              Quality field sliver dihedral angle.    
                              During quality improvement all field    
                              elements with an angle greater than     
                              angdfs are considered sliver elements   
                              and are minimized by inserting a node   
                              near the element centroid. Only         
                              applicable if the quality field sliver  
                              deletion flag is on (mdfs=1).           
 
150       120       179.9     angmax                  
                              Satisfied dihedral element angle.       
                              An element is considered satisfied if it
                              has a maximum angle less than angmax and
                              if all of its edge lengths are          
                              satisfied. Also an element will not be  
                              created inside a boundary element if it 
                              would create a maximum element angle    
                              greater than angmax.                    
 
179.5     0         180       angqbf                  
                              Maximum planar surface angle.           
                              Planar surface angle for boundary       
                              triangular faces used to check the      
                              boundary surface triangulation. The     
                              boundary surface triangulation is not   
                              considered valid if the planar angle for
                              a vertex of any face is greater than    
                              angqbf.                                 
 
160       0         180       angqbfm                 
                              Maximum planar surface angle.           
                              Planar surface angle for boundary       
                              triangular faces used to check for a    
                              low-quality boundary surface            
                              triangulation. If the planar angle for  
                              a vertex of any face is greater than    
                              angqbfm then the triangulation is       
                              considered low-quality and mrec4 is set 
                              to a value of 1 (turns on reconnection  
                              of 4-4 element combinations during grid 
                              generation). This low-quality test also 
                              turns on boundary surface face          
                              reconnection (see mrecbm).              
 
160       90        179.9     angqmax                 
                              Low quality dihedral element angle.     
                              Quality improvement is repeated if there
                              are elements with a maximum angle       
                              greater than angqmax.                   
 
120       90        179.9     angqmsk                 
                              Masking dihedral element angle.         
                              Special quality improvement operations  
                              are performed on elements with a maximum
                              angle greater than angqmsk.             
 
175       90        179.9     angqrmax                
                              Very low quality dihedral element angle.
                              Quality improvement and re-generation   
                              are repeated up to nqr times if there   
                              are any elements with a maximum dihderal
                              angle greater than angqrmax. Also,      
                              quality grid re-generation will continue
                              if there are any elements with a maximum
                              dihderal angle greater than angqrmax.   
 
160       70        179.9     angqrgen                
                              Re-generation dihedral element angle.   
                              Quality improvement grid re-generation  
                              is performed on low-quality element     
                              regions with a maximum dihedral angle   
                              greater than angqrgen. Only applicable  
                              if the quality improvement re-gen. flag 
                              is on (mqrgen=1).                       
 
120       70        179.9     angqual                 
                              Final quality dihedral element angle.   
                              Local reconnection for quality          
                              improvement is performed on elements    
                              with a maximum angle greater than       
                              angqual.                                
 
150       120       179.9     angrbfdd                
                              Discontinuous dihedral surface angle.   
                              Dihedral angle between two adjacent     
                              faces used to limit boundary surface    
                              recovery reconnection. The boundary     
                              surface triangulation will not be       
                              reconnected if the result is a dihedral 
                              angle between the two faces which is    
                              less than angrbfdd.                     
 
120       100       179.9     angrbfdd2               
                              Discontinuous dihedral surface angle 2. 
                              Same as angrbfdd except that it is used 
                              only if boundary recovery fails.        
 
110       60        179.9     angrbfmxd               
                              Maximum angle for curvature improvement.
                              Maximum planar face angle for           
                              curvature improvement reconnection.     
                              Planar face angle used to limit boundary
                              surface curvature reconnection. The     
                              boundary surface triangulation will not 
                              be reconnected to improve curvature if  
                              the reconnected maximum angle is greater
                              than angrbfmxd.                         
 
140       60        179.9     angrbfmxp               
                              Maximum planar face angle.              
                              Planar face angle used to limit boundary
                              surface recovery reconnection. The      
                              boundary surface triangulation will not 
                              be reconnected if the result is a       
                              greater maximum angle and if the        
                              reconnected maximum angle is greater    
                              than angrbfmxp.                         
 
2         0         10        angrbfsd                
                              Small dihedral surface angle.           
                              Dihedral angle between two adjacent     
                              faces used to check the boundary surface
                              triangulation. The boundary surface     
                              triangulation is not considered valid if
                              the dihedral angle (within the domain)  
                              between two faces is less than angrbfsd.
 
100       1         1e+07     arrbfn                  
                              Bnd. recvry. normal trnsf. aspect-ratio.
                              Unrecovered boundary faces are          
                              transformed locally using an aspect     
                              ratio of arrbfn.                        
 
2         1         1e+07     arrbfp                  
                              Bnd. recovery pair transf. aspect-ratio.
                              Unrecovered boundary face pairs are     
                              transformed locally using an aspect     
                              ratio of arrbfp.                        
 
0         0         1e+07     arrecbf                 
                              Maximum aspect-ratio for boundary faces.
                              Boundary faces are not reconnected to   
                              improve quality if their aspect-ratio   
                              is greater than arrecbf. If arrecbf = 0 
                              then the aspect-ratio is not checked.   
                              Applies to the initial boundary surface 
                              grid only. This option is not applicable
                              if boundary face reconnection is turned 
                              off (mrecbm=0).                         
 
1         1         1e+07     artrmin                 
                              Transformation minimum aspect-ratio.    
                              If mtrb = 1 then a transformation is    
                              used to account for boundary face       
                              aspect-ratio. If the maximum boundary   
                              face aspect-ratio is below artmin then  
                              no transformation is used.              
                              Only applicable if the boundary face    
                              aspect-ratio transformation flag is on  
                              (mtrb=1).                               
 
1         1         100000    bdfmchk                 
                              Oct-tree bin checking size factor.      
                              Factor used during generation of the    
                              boundary surface node oct-tree used for 
                              checking source nodes. The size of the  
                              smallest oct-tree bins are set to the   
                              boundary node distribution function     
                              multiplied by bdfmchk. Only applicable  
                              if the source option flag is on         
                              (msource>=1) or if sources are created  
                              to reduce intial grid length scales.    
 
1         1         100000    bdfmeval                
                              Oct-tree bin evaluation size factor.    
                              Factor used during generation of the    
                              source node oct-tree used for evaluating
                              distribution function and transformation
                              vector from source nodes. The size of   
                              the smallest oct-tree bins are set to   
                              the source node distribution function   
                              multiplied by bdfmeval. Only applicable 
                              if the source option flag and source    
                              node grid options are on (msource=2).   
 
0.25      0         1         bfdwrec                 
                              Boundary curvature improvement factor.  
                              Boundary face curvature improvement     
                              reconnection factor. Boundary faces are 
                              not reconnected to improve curvature    
                              matching if the improvement in the      
                              curvature weight is not more than       
                              bfdwrec. The weight varies between zero 
                              and one.                                
 
0.866     0         10        cartrm                  
                              Transformation aspect-ratio coefficient.
                              If mtrb = 1 then a transformation is    
                              used to account for boundary face       
                              aspect-ratio. The transformation vector 
                              magnitude is equal to the boundary face 
                              aspect-ratio multiplied by cartrm.      
                              Only applicable if the boundary face    
                              aspect-ratio transformation flag is on  
                              (mtrb=1).                               
 
2         1.5       100000    cbidx                   
                              Initial bounding box size factor.       
                              The initial bounding box used for       
                              insertion of all boundary nodes is sized
                              to be equal to the size of the actual   
                              domain plus cbidx multiplied by the size
                              of the actual domain.                   
 
1e-08     0         0.01      cbmv1                   
                              Initial bndry node movement tolerance.  
                              Initial node movement relative magnitude
                              for boundary node insertion.            
 
0.001     0         0.01      cbmv2                   
                              Final boundary node movement tolerance. 
                              Final node movement relative magnitude  
                              for boundary node insertion.            
 
10        2         1e+06     cbmvm                   
                              Boundary node movement multiplier.      
                              Node movement relative magnitude        
                              multiplier for boundary node insertion. 
 
1.5       1.1       3         cdff                    
                              Satisfied edge length multiplier.       
                              An edge is considered satisfied if its  
                              length divided by cdff is less than the 
                              average of the node distribution        
                              function at the edge end-nodes.         
 
2         1.1       10        cdffbcf                 
                              Frozen element edge length multiplier 1.
                              Satisfied edge length multiplier used   
                              to determine elements associated with   
                              frozen boundary faces. See description  
                              standard satisfied edge length          
                              multiplier, cdff, for reference.        
 
0.7       0.5       0.9       cdfn                    
                              Nearby node factor.                     
                              Nodes are considered too close if the   
                              distance between them is less than their
                              average node distribution functions     
                              multiplied by cdfn.                     
 
2         0.5       100       cdfnbcf                 
                              Frozen boundary face nearby node factor.
                              Nodes are considered too close to a     
                              frozen boundary face node if the        
                              distance between them is less than their
                              average node distribution functions     
                              multiplied by cdfnbcf.                  
 
1         0.5       1e+06     cdfqrg                  
                              Inl. re-generation dist. function mult. 
                              The initial re-generation distribution  
                              function multiplier cdfqrg is used to   
                              specify the relative element size during
                              quality improvement grid re-generation. 
                              Only applicable if the quality          
                              improvement re-gen. flag is on          
                              (mqrgen=1).                             
 
0.5       1e-06     1e+06     cdfqrgmin               
                              Min. re-generation dist. function mult. 
                              The minimum re-generation distribution  
                              function multiplier cdfqrgmin is used to
                              limit the minimum distribution function 
                              multiplier during quality improvement   
                              grid re-generation. Only applicable if  
                              the quality improvement re-gen. flag is 
                              on (mqrgen=1).                          
 
1         0.5       1         cdvtol                  
                              Delaunay tolerance exponent.            
                              Final Delaunay circumsphere tolerance   
                              exponent for boundary node insertion.   
 
0.01      1e-06     0.1       cdvtolr                 
                              Delaunay tolerance reduction factor.    
                              Delaunay circumsphere tolerance         
                              reduction factor for boundary node      
                              insertion.                              
 
0.8       0.1       10        cmelem                  
                              Maximum element estimate coefficient.   
                              Coefficient used to determine an        
                              estimate for the maximum number of      
                              elements required. The estimate varies  
                              linearly with cmelem. Higher values of  
                              cmelem will result in higher estimates. 
 
1.25      1.01      2         cmelemi                 
                              Maximum element ratio.                  
                              Ratio of number of elements estimated   
                              per number of initial elements. The     
                              maximum number of final elements        
                              allocated is set to the number of       
                              elements in the initial grid multiplied 
                              by cmelemi. This is used only if the    
                              input grid is a volume triangulation.   
 
0.001     0         0.1       cmv1                    
                              Initial node movement tolerance.        
                              Initial node movement relative magnitude
                              for node insertion.                     
 
0.1       0         0.25      cmv2                    
                              Final node movement tolerance.          
                              Final node movement relative magnitude  
                              for node insertion.                     
 
10        2         1e+06     cmvm                    
                              Node movement multiplier.               
                              Node movement relative magnitude        
                              multiplier for node insertion.          
 
1.25      1         3         cnnpnni                 
                              Number of initial nodes multiplier.     
                              The number of nodes allocated for the   
                              initial volume triangulation is set to  
                              the number of initial nodes multiplied  
                              by cnnpnni. Additional nodes beyond     
                              those in the initial surface grid may be
                              required to complete boundary recovery  
                              and obtain an initial volume            
                              triangulation.                          
 
1         0         1e+07     crbf                    
                              Boundary recovery point placement factor
                              Additional points are created for       
                              unrecovered boundary faces. Points are  
                              placed above and below the face based on
                              minimum local element size and the      
                              factor crbf.                            
 
1.25      1.05      2         crealloc                
                              Reallocation multiplier.                
                              The maximum number of elements and nodes
                              is increased and all arrays are         
                              reallocated if more elements or nodes   
                              are required to complete the grid. The  
                              allocations for each array are increased
                              by crealloc multiplied by their current 
                              value. The new array size is limited by 
                              the maximum number of new array elements
                              set in parameter nmnrealloc.            
 
0.8       0.4       0.9       csmin                   
                              Tolerance exponent for searching.       
                              Volume coordinate tolerance exponent for
                              searching.                              
 
0.25      0.125     0.9       csmini                  
                              Tolerance exponent for insertion.       
                              Volume coordinate tolerance exponent for
                              node insertion.                         
 
0.5       0         1         csmth                   
                              Smoothing coefficient.                  
 
0.94      0.8       0.94      ctol                    
                              Overall tolerance exponent.             
                              Field grid generation and quality       
                              improvement tolerance exponent.         
 
0.88      0.5       0.94      ctolm                   
                              Initial grid volume tolerance exponent. 
 
0.5       0.4       0.94      ctoli                   
                              Initial tolerance exponent              
                              Used to determine tolerance used during 
                              deletion of construction elements and   
                              sub-grid generation phases of initial   
                              grid generation.                        
 
1         0         180       dangqrgen               
                              Re-generation element angle tolerance.  
                              Quality improvement grid re-generation  
                              is performed on low-quality element     
                              regions. The re-generated grid is       
                              accepted if the local maximum dihedral  
                              angle is decreased by dangqrgen. Only   
                              applicable if the quality improvement   
                              re-gen. flag is on (mqrgen=1).          
 
0.1       1e-06     1e+06     dcdfqrg                 
                              Re-generation dist. funct. mult. factor.
                              The intial re-generation distribution   
                              function multiplier cdfqrg is reduced   
                              iteratively by the factor dcdfqrg during
                              quality improvement grid re-generation  
                              if quality does not improve. Only       
                              applicable if the quality improvement   
                              re-gen. flag is on (mqrgen=1).          
 
0.0001    1e-18     0.1       dvtol0                  
                              Initial Delaunay tolerance value.       
                              value for boundary node insertion.      
 
0.0001    0         1         lsrlimit                
                              LSRatio improvement limit factor.       
                              Source nodes are generated to improve   
                              the minimum length scale ratio          
                              (LSRatio), minimum point spacing over   
                              distance between boundaries.. If the    
                              minimum LSRatio is less than lsrlimit   
                              then source nodes will be generated. A  
                              value of lsrlimit=0 will turn off       
                              surface or iterative mode LSRatio       
 
2         1.1       1e+06     lsrszmin                
                              LSRatio surface mode size factor.       
                              Source nodes are generated to improve   
                              the minimum length scale ratio          
                              (LSRatio). In surface mode, source nodes
                              are generated on a box the size of the  
                              inner domain multiplied by a calculated 
                              factor that is limited to not be less   
                              than lsrszmin. Only applicable if the   
                              surface mode LSRatio improvement flag is
                              on (mlsr=1).                            
 
0.1       0         1         relem0                  
                              Re-numbering limit.                     
                              Elements are not re-numbered if the     
                              ratio of elements to be moved to total  
                              elements is less than relem0.           
 
0.5       0         1         vsmthb                  
                              Smoothing reduction factor.             
                              Smoothing coefficient reduction factor  
                              for all nodes adjacent to a boundary.   
 
165       120       179.9     angpmax1                
                              Partition dihedral element angle 1.     
                              An element is considered satisfied if it
                              has a maximum angle less than angpmax1  
                              and if all of its edge lengths are      
                              satisfied. Elements in a partition are  
                              initially considered unsatisfied if they
                              do not meet the standard limits set by  
                              angpmax1 and cdffp1. If all of the      
                              unsatisfied elements in a complete      
                              sub-volume meet the limits set by       
                              angpmax2 and cdffp2 then they are all   
                              considered satisfied if mpdone=1.       
                              Elements that are are not in the        
                              completed partition remain part of the  
                              iterative partitioning process and may  
                              be further subdivided or reconnected.   
                              Only applicable if partition mode option
                              is on (mpartm=1) and more than one      
                              partition is requested (npart>1).       
 
180       120       180       angpmax2                
                              Partition dihedral element angle 2.     
                              An element is considered satisfied if it
                              has a maximum angle less than angpmax1  
                              and if all of its edge lengths are      
                              satisfied. Elements in a partition are  
                              initially considered unsatisfied if they
                              do not meet the standard limits set by  
                              angpmax1 and cdffp1. If all of the      
                              unsatisfied elements in a complete      
                              sub-volume meet the limits set by       
                              angpmax2 and cdffp2 then they are all   
                              considered satisfied if mpdone=1.       
                              Elements that are are not in the        
                              completed partition remain part of the  
                              iterative partitioning process and may  
                              be further subdivided or reconnected.   
                              Only applicable if partition mode option
                              is on (mpartm=1) and more than one      
                              partition is requested (npart>1).       
 
1.8       1.1       3         cdffp1                  
                              Partition edge length multiplier 1.     
                              An edge is considered satisfied if its  
                              length divided by cdffp1 is less than   
                              the average of the node distribution    
                              function at the edge end-nodes. Only    
                              applicable if partition mode option is  
                              on (mpartm=1) and more than one         
                              partition is requested (npart>1).       
 
2         1.1       3         cdffp2                  
                              Partition edge length multiplier 2.     
                              An edge is considered satisfied if its  
                              length divided by cdffp2 is less than   
                              the average of the node distribution    
                              function at the edge end-nodes. Only    
                              applicable if partition mode option is  
                              on (mpartm=1) and more than one         
                              partition is requested (npart>1).       
 
0.7       0         0.9       cdfnn                   
                              Nearby expanded check node factor.      
                              Potential new nodes are considered too  
                              close to existing nodes found during    
                              expanded checking if the distance       
                              between them is less than their average 
                              node distribution functions multiplied  
                              by cdfnn. If cdfnn=0 then expanded      
                              checking is turned off. Only applicable 
                              if partition mode option is on          
                              (mpartm=1) and more than one partition  
                              is requested (npart>1).                 
 
0.5       0.1       10        cmelemp                 
                              Partition mode maximum element coeff.   
                              Coefficient used to determine an        
                              estimate for the maximum number of      
                              elements required. The estimate varies  
                              linearly with cmelemp. Higher values of 
                              cmelemp will result in higher estimates.
                              Only applicable if partition mode option
                              is on (mpartm=1) and more than one      
                              partition is requested (npart>1).       
 
15        0         90        angbldd                 
                              BL discontinuous surface angle.         
                              Discontinuous surface nodes are defined 
                              as those with an angle between the BL   
                              node normal vector and any surrounding  
                              boundary face normal vector greater than
                              angbldd. At discontinuous surface nodes 
                              the BL normal vector smoothing and BL   
                              termination criteria are modified. Also,
                              the maximum allowable BL element        
                              dihedral angle is increased from        
                              angblqmax up to a maximum of angblqmaxd 
                              dependent upon the level of             
                              discontinuity. At a discontinuity angle 
                              of angbldd the maximum dihedral angle   
                              is angblqmax and at an angle of angbldd2
                              it is angblqmaxd. Note that angbldd will
                              have no effect unless it is less than   
                              angbldd2. The value of angbldd is       
                              internally limited to be less than      
                              angbldd2. If the SL flag is on (mbl=2)  
                              then the maximum dihedral angle is set  
                              by angslqmax and angslqmaxd. Only       
                              appl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is on  
                              (mbl!=0).                               
 
85        0         90        angbldd2                
                              BL highly discontinuous surface angle.  
                              Highly discontinuous surface nodes are  
                              defined as those with an angle between  
                              the BL node normal vector and any       
                              surrounding boundary face normal vector 
                              greater than angbldd2. Also, the maximum
                              allowable BL element dihedral angle is  
                              increased from angblqmax up to a maximum
                              of angblqmaxd dependent upon the level  
                              of discontinuity. At a discontinuity    
                              angle of angbldd the maximum dihedral   
                              angle is angblqmax and at an angle of   
                              angbldd2 it is angblqmaxd. If the SL    
                              flag is on (mbl=2) then the maximum     
                              dihedral angle is set by angslqmax and  
                              angslqmaxd. Only applicable if the      
                              B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).          
 
170       100       180       angblisimx              
                              Maximum angle between BL int. faces.    
                              Maximum included angle between faces on 
                              a BL intersecting surface and adjacent  
                              BL generation surface faces. Only       
                              appl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is on  
                              (mbl!=0).                               
 
0.5       0         10        angblipmax              
                              Maximum normal deviation on a plane.    
                              Maximum deviation from BL intersecting  
                              plane normal that is allowed for each   
                              boundary face normal of the plane is    
                              angblipmax. The BL intersecting plane   
                              normal is set to the average of all     
                              boundary face normals of that plane.    
                              Only applicable if the automatic        
                              boundary condition option is on         
                              (msetbc=1) and the BL/SL/SNS flag is on 
                              (mbl!=0).                               
 
2         0         45        angblsd                 
                              BL small dihedral angle.                
                              BL elements are rejected if the dihedral
                              angle between an element face and an    
                              adjacent face is less than angblsd. BL  
                              grid advancement is terminated locally  
                              when an element is rejected. Only       
                              appl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is on  
                              (mbl!=0).                               
 
0         0         10        angrbfsd2               
                              Small dihedral surface angle.           
                              Same as angrbfsd except that it is used 
                              only during secondary grid generation   
                              in cases with BL regions. Only          
                              appl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is on  
                              (mbl!=0).                               
 
0         0         1000      cblchkbb                
                              Intersection checking box size factor.  
                              The size of the bounding box for        
                              checking BL interface edge-face         
                              intersections is increased in all       
                              directions by the local normal spacing  
                              multiplied by the sum of the factors    
                              cdfn and cblchkbb. Increasing           
                              cblchkbb will increase the number of    
                              faces and edges that are checked for    
                              intersections. Only applicable if the   
                              B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).          
 
0.7       0         1000      cblcncv                 
                              Concave BL region factor.               
                              BL advancement is locally terminated in 
                              concave regions if the normal aspect    
                              ratio is larger than cblcncvmnr. A      
                              region is considered concave if the     
                              local ratio of edge lengths within the  
                              BL to the corresponding edges on the    
                              initial surface is less than cblcncv.   
                              Only applicable if the BL/SL flag is on 
                              (mbl!=0).                               
 
3         1         1000      cblsrchbb               
                              Nearby node search bnd. box size factor.
                              The size of the bounding box for        
                              determining if a BL node is nearby is   
                              set equal to the local length scale     
                              multiplied by the factor cblsrchbb.     
                              These nearby BL nodes are used for      
                              checking for possible face              
                              intersections within the BL region.     
                              Only appl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is
                              on (mbl!=0).                            
 
1.2       1         1000      cblsrchbb2              
                              Nearby surf search bnd. box size factor.
                              The size of the bounding box for        
                              determining if a non-BL surface node is 
                              nearby a BL node is set equal to the    
                              local length scale multiplied by the    
                              factor cblsrchbb2. These nearby surface 
                              nodes are used for checking for possible
                              intersections with the neaerby BL       
                              region. Only applicable if the BL/SL/SNS
                              flag is on (mbl!=0).                    
 
1         0         1e+19     cbltrm                  
                              Anisotropic blending coefficient.       
                              Anisotropic transformation vectors can  
                              be used to blend from anisotropic       
                              aspect-ratio BL elements to isotropic   
                              elements. The magnitude of the normal   
                              direction transformation vector is      
                              multiplied by cbltrm (magnitude reduced 
                              if cbltrm<1 or increased if cbltrm>1).  
                              Only appl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is
                              on (mbl!=0) and anisotropic to isotropic
                              aspect-ratio blending is on (mtrsrcb=1).
 
1.2       1.001     3         cdsblr                  
                              Blended BL surface growth rate.         
                              Used as the starting geometric growth   
                              rate of the initial normal spacing on   
                              blended BL surfaces. Only applicable if 
                              the set adjacent surface to BL flag is  
                              on (msetabl=1) and if the CFD BL flag is
                              on (mbl=1).                             
 
1.5       1.001     4         cdsblrm                 
                              Maximum blended BL surface growth rate. 
                              Maximum geometric growth rate for the   
                              initial normal spacing on blended BL    
                              surfaces. Only applicable if the set    
                              adjacent surface to BL flag is on       
                              (msetabl=1) and if the CFD BL flag is   
                              on (mbl=1).                             
 
1.05      1         2         dcdsblr                 
                              Blended BL surface acceleration rate    
                              The blended BL surface initial normal   
                              spacing increases at a rate equal to    
                              dcdsblr. Only applicable if the set     
                              adjacent surface to BL flag is on       
                              (msetabl=1) and if the CFD BL flag is on
                              (mbl=1).                                
 
0.1       0         10        dfsmthlim               
                              Distribution func BL smoothing limit    
                              The distribution function values used to
                              limit the BL are smoothed up to ndfsmth 
                              iterations. If the maximum change for   
                              the nodes of a given boundary surface   
                              face is less than dfsmthlim then        
                              smoothing is terminated. Only applicable
                              if the BL/SL/SNS flag is on (mbl!=0).   
 
0.001     0         1         dfsmthtol               
                              Distribution func BL smoothing tolerance
                              The distribution function values used to
                              limit the BL are smoothed up to ndfsmth 
                              iterations. If the maximum relative     
                              change between iterations is less than  
                              dfsmthtol then smoothing is terminated. 
                              Only applicable if the BL/SL/SNS flag is
                              on (mbl!=0).                            
 
100       1         1e+06     dsblfmax                
                              BL spacing thickness factor.            
                              The normal spacing is multiplied by a   
                              factor between one and dsblfmax at all  
                              nodes to attempt and keep the layer     
                              thickness constant on surrounding       
                              boundary faces. Only applicable if the  
                              BL spacing thickness factor option is on
                              (mdsblf=1).                             
 
0.3       0         1e+06     sminj                   
                              Face intersection location tolerance.   
                              Relative tolerance for checking if BL   
                              interface faces intersect near rebuild  
                              too close.
